At the heart of a secret criminal life is a powerful psychological mechanism known as compartmentalization. This allows an individual to hold two completely contradictory sets of beliefs and behaviors without experiencing conscious discomfort. A seemingly devoted family man can embezzle from his employer, rationalizing that the company "owes" him or that he is "just borrowing" the money. A respected teacher can sell stolen goods online, separating their identity as an educator from their role as a fence. In his seminal work, The Criminal Personality , Dr. Samuel Yochelson describes this process as the "turning off" of the conscience for specific, time-limited acts. By building a mental wall between their "good" self and their "criminal" self, these individuals can look at themselves in the mirror each morning, genuinely believing they are not a "bad person." This self-deception is the first and most crucial step in building a sustainable double life.
